Definition
  1. Noun:
    • National ceremony / state ceremony: An official, formal public event or ritual of great importance, organized and recognized by a nation or its government. It often commemorates a significant national event, historical figure, or embodies state tradition.
    • National holiday: A public holiday recognized and celebrated across the entire nation, often marked by official ceremonies.
Usage Examples
  • Noun:
    • Lễ Quốc khánh một quốc lễ quan trọng. (National Day is an important national ceremony.)
    • Cả nước nghỉ làm trong ngày quốc lễ đó. (The whole country has a day off on that national holiday.)
Advanced Usage
  • The term is formal and used in official or historical contexts to denote events of the highest ceremonial order for a country.
Variants and Related Words
  • Lễ quốc gia: (n) A synonym for "quốc lễ," meaning national ceremony.
  • Ngày lễ quốc gia: (n) National holiday.
  • Quốc tang: (n) State funeral; a specific type of national ceremony.

Related Concepts
  • Lễ hội: (n) Festival; a broader term for celebrations, which can be local or cultural, not necessarily national.
  • Nghi lễ: (n) Ritual; refers more to the prescribed form of the ceremony itself.
